What is the difference in between a dentist and an orthodontist? To respond to a question that is usually asked, both dentists and orthodontists help individuals obtain far better oral health, albeit in various methods. It assists to keep in mind that dental care is a rather wide scientific research with different medical specializations. All dental practitioners, consisting of orthodontists, deal with the teeth, periodontals, jaw and nerves.

Orthodontists and dentists both offer dental look after individuals. Orthodontists can work in an oral workplace and offer the same treatments as other dental practitioners. You can think of both doctors that treat periodontal and teeth troubles. The main difference is that becoming an orthodontist requires a particular specialized in dealing with the imbalance of the teeth and jaw.

An orthodontist is a dental professional that has undergone training to specialize in the medical diagnosis, prevention and therapy of abnormalities in the jaw and teeth. They can likewise recognize possible troubles in teeth alignment that may develop when conditions are left without treatment (best orthodontist near me).

This includes all the needed education to come to be a general dental practitioner. According to the American Student Dental Organization (ASDA), it implies you will certainly require to have either a Medical professional of Medicine in Dental Care (DMD) or a Physician of Oral Surgery (DDS). In other words, orthodontists need to finish dental institution and then obtain an orthodontics specialized education and learning.

As soon as you have actually completed your orthodontic training, you have the alternative to obtain board accreditation. Orthodontists work with a details collection of oral problems, indicating they treat misalignments in the teeth and other relevant irregularities. Some of the conditions that they deal with consist of the following: Jaw misalignment Teeth that are also much apart Jampacked teeth Overbites Underbites Jagged teeth As you can see, these are specific kinds of dental problems apart from the usual troubles general dental professionals take care of.

Causey OrthodonticsThe general objective of an orthodontist is to improve a person's bite. Not everybody is birthed with straight teeth, and an orthodontist will certainly make sure that clients obtain equally spaced straight teeth.

Malocclusion, or misaligned teeth, can result in oral issues, including tooth decay, gum condition, and difficult or agonizing eating. Not every person is birthed with straight teeth. If you have a bad bite or big areas between your teeth, you might want to seek advice from a dental practitioner specializing in orthodontic treatment.

(Image Credit History: DigitalVision/Getty Images) Orthodontists use taken care of and detachable oral gadgets, like braces, retainers, and bands, to transform the position of teeth in your mouth. Orthodontic treatment is for dental problems, consisting of: Uneven teethBite troubles, like an overbite or an underbiteCrowded teeth or teeth that are also much apartJaw misalignmentThe objective of orthodontic treatment is to enhance your bite.

Imbalance, or malocclusion, is the most usual reason individuals see an orthodontist. It is genetic and is the result of dimension distinctions between the top and reduced jaw or between the jaw and teeth. orthodontist services. Malocclusion causes tooth overcrowding, a twisted jaw, or irregular bite patterns. Malocclusion is usually treated with: Your orthodontist connects steel, ceramic, or plastic square bonds to your teeth.

If you have just small malocclusion, you may be able to utilize clear braces, called aligners, rather of conventional dental braces. Some individuals require a headgear to assist relocate teeth right into line with pressure from outside the mouth. After dental braces or aligners, you'll need to use a retainer. A retainer is a customized tool that maintains your teeth in location.
